I just got my new Vanquish II Level 2 today.  Everything works great but the fans seem a bit loud to me...with just a little bit of rattle or annoying sound to them. Is this normal? Is there a way to make them quieter?

If there's a rattling sound, it could be a bad fan. If they're too loud then go into Bios, Del key while booting, and on the Bios EZ screen you can adjust fans to Quiet, Standard, etc.

One of the things you can do is run the machine with the case open and try to find the fan making the noise...  iirc there are 2 fans in the front, 1 on the bottom (PSU), 1 in the back and 2 or 3 on the video card. If you find the one that rattles, give a press in center to see if it needs to be reseated.

Thanks for the help everyone. I opened it up and found that a cable was up against the graphic card fan which  was causing the sound. Tucked the cable out of the way.  Now she is silent and ready for World of Warcraft.
